Seasonal Market Trends: Timing Your Purchase
Understanding seasonal market trends is essential for buyers and investors looking to make strategic decisions. In Mimico, the real estate market tends to be more active during the spring and fall, with increased listings and competitive pricing. Properties like the Battleford Apartments and the Leamington Apartments often see heightened interest during these peak seasons.
For those seeking a more relaxed buying experience, the winter months may offer opportunities to negotiate better deals, as the market typically slows down. However, it's important to note that inventory may be limited during this time.
